Certified Birth and Death Certificates

Our office issues certified copies of certificates for births and deaths occurring from 1908 to present in Franklin County only.

  • Registers all births, deaths, and fetal deaths occurring in Franklin County.
  • Issues burial transit permits.
  • Helps single parents with completing “Acknowledgement of Paternity Affidavits."
  • Assists customers with correcting information on birth and death certificates issued in Franklin County.

Who Is The Program For?

All customers and agencies needing birth and death certificates for births and deaths that occurred in Franklin County.

How To Use The Program

To Get a birth or death certificate:

Complete an application for a birth or death certificate.  The applications can be mailed, faxed, or brought into the Columbus Public Health, Vital Statistics Office.  Certificates can also be ordered online with a debit or credit card for an additional $9.95 fee through "Vitalcheck."   Click on Franklin County Bureau of Vital Statistics on the Vitalcheck homepage.

To inquire about a birth or death certificate requested by mail which you have not received:
  • It takes approximately 7-10 business days to process mail requests including mail requests made with a debit or credit card.
  • We can only issue certificates for births and deaths occurring in Franklin County from 1908 to present.  
  • Birth certificates for newborns are not ready for about 8 to 10 weeks after the child is born.
  • According to City of Columbus Charter, Section 82, your check will be deposited within 24 hours. If your check has cleared and was sent within the last 2 weeks, your request is being processed.  To correct a birth certificate

     (1)  Circle the mistake.
     (2)  Write the correct spelling next to it.
     (3)  Return in person or mail all certified copies to:

Columbus Public Health     
Vital Statistics
240 Parsons Avenue
Columbus, OH  43215

      For corrections requested by mail, please include your mailing address and daytime
      phone number. It takes about 10 business days to correct a certificate.

      **Please Note:  We must have the incorrect certificate(s) to issue a corrected
                                  certificate.  Columbus Public Health can correct data entry 
                                  errors only.

  • If an affidavit is needed to correct the mistake, we will send the affidavit form to you.
  • If the mistake needs to be corrected by probate court, we will send you more information on what to do.
To correct a death certificate:

 Contact the funeral home that submitted the original information.

Cost

Certified birth and death certificates are $20 each. Only certified copies are available. Requests by mail usually take 7-10 business days. Service is also available by telephone, internet and fax with a debit or credit card for an additional $9.95.  For Express service within U.S., please add $15.00 for overnight delivery or $13.00 for 2-3 day delivery- Express service is payable by credit or debit card only. Express delivery orders must be called in to 1-877-648-0605, or placed online at www.vitalchek.com, or faxed in to 614-645-0730.

Birth & Death Records in Ohio from 1867 through December 20, 1908 are kept by the probate court of each county. There is NO statewide index to Ohio birth & death records prior to December 20, 1908.

For Paternity Information (For single parents –adding father's name to birth certificate) contact:

The local Vital Statistics agency, or the Paternity Enhancement Program for an "Acknowledgment of Paternity Affidavit” form.  Completion of the form is voluntary.  Both the natural father and mother of the child are required to sign this affidavit.  The affidavit may be signed by both parents at the same time or at different times; however, each signature must be notarized at the time of signing.
